How to Install an Access Panel in the Ceiling


Installing an access panel in the ceiling can significantly improve maintenance access to hidden systems such as plumbing, electrical wiring, or HVAC components. This straightforward task requires minimal tools and materials, making it a popular DIY project. In this article, we’ll guide you through the step-by-step process of installing an access panel in your ceiling.


Materials and Tools Required


Before you start the installation, gather the following materials and tools


- Access panel - Measuring tape - Utility knife or drywall saw - Level - Screwdriver - Stud finder - Drywall screws or anchors - Pencil - Safety goggles


Step 1 Choose the Right Location


The first step in installing an access panel is to determine the best location. Identify the area that requires access, ensuring it is free from obstructions like beams or ducts. Use a stud finder to check for any structural components in the ceiling. The panel should be placed in an easily accessible spot while allowing for adequate clearance.


Step 2 Measure and Mark


Once you have chosen the location, measure the dimensions of the access panel. Use a measuring tape to mark the outline of the panel on the ceiling with a pencil. Ensure that the markings are straight and level to enable a proper fit.


Step 3 Cut the Opening

Using a utility knife or drywall saw, cut along the marked lines to create an opening for the panel. Be cautious during this step; make sure not to damage any existing wiring or piping. It is advisable to wear safety goggles to protect your eyes from dust and debris.


Step 4 Install the Access Panel


After cutting the opening, it’s time to install the access panel. Most panels come with mounting brackets or tabs. Position the panel into the opening, ensuring it fits snugly. If the panel includes screws, use the screwdriver to secure it in place, or use drywall screws or anchors if the panel requires additional support.


Step 5 Check for Alignment


Once the access panel is installed, step back and visually inspect the alignment of the panel with the ceiling. Use a level to ensure the panel is evenly positioned. If it appears uneven, carefully make adjustments as necessary.


Step 6 Finishing Touches


To enhance the appearance of the access panel and blend it with the ceiling, you may want to apply a coat of paint around the edges. Make sure to use a paint that matches your ceiling color. This step is optional but can improve the aesthetics of the installation.
